This week we have been given a color challenge for CAS224: melon mambo, crumb cake, pear pizzaz, white (hot pink, kraft, lt. yellow-green, white).
For my card, I decided to use a stamp set from Paper Smooches called "I Heart Art". I stamped the easel image with Marvy black dye ink onto a piece of X-Press It cardstock. I colored the "wood" on the easel with Copic markers. I stamped the paint splatter image twice...once with Colorbox Lemon Grass pigment ink and once with Colorbox Pink pigment ink. I added a pink rhinestone for a little bling. I then cut around the easel with detailed scissors.
I placed the image onto a piece of kraft cardstock, rounded at the corners with a punch. I drew with a Memento Tuxedo Black marker the floor line. Then, I stamped the sentiment, also from Paper Smooches, with Versafine Onyx Black onto the kraft base. I finished the card by tying some Baker's Twine near the top of the card.
